What locals are saying
Muddy's Dockside Bar is widely regarded as the low-key, unpretentious alternative to the flashier Shem Creek bars — a sand-floored dive with waterfront marsh views described by regulars as 'a little slice of Key West.' Locals consistently point to the affordable happy hour and friendly bartenders as its core draws, with sunset watching from the outdoor dock being the signature experience. A small number of longer-term regulars have noted disappointment in recent visits (one 15-year regular stating 'no more'), but the majority consensus still calls it a tucked-away gem worth seeking out.
